Passou Ngongang unveils first musical album

New artiste, Passou Ngongang has launched his first album 'Sitcha'a'. The album which consists of 10 tracks has a combination of charm and dreamlike tunes.

According to him the songs were based on the struggles and experience people face in life including him. The song entitled ‘Sitcha’a’ which was sang in ‘balengou’ talks about where the world is heading and how the future generation is plagued with many doubts.

He disclosed that his decision to include the local dialect, ‘balengou’ in his album was influenced on how refined and soothing the language sounds. Passou also added that he fused salsa with Bantu sounds to make the songs sound more pleasant.

In as much as he tries to deny being a celebrity he believes some of the songs which are in English will pave way for international recognition.

The launch which was themed ‘Africa’ saw remarkable performances by Passou, Sanzy Viany, choirs and other experienced musicians. Passou promises his fans to stay tuned for more of his songs.
